About Us

Independent Artist Group (IAG) was born upon the merger of Agency for the Performing Arts (APA) and Artist Group International (IAG) in the summer of 2023. IAG combines the breadth of APA’s renowned full-service representation capabilities as a talent and literary agency in the entertainment industry, with AGI’s reputation as the premiere independent music touring agency with a roster of superstar stadium and arena acts as well as cutting-edged emerging artists in the music and comedy worlds. The result is a powerful new voice in artist representation with the entrepreneurial passion to create ground-breaking partnerships for our clients across multiple platforms and business lines, combined with the deal making acumen and deep relationships that come from their combined 95-year legacies in the representation business.


What We Are Looking For

IAG seeks a highly motivated junior level attorney to join our Business and Legal Affairs department in our Los Angeles Office. This position will support our Business and Legal Affairs team. The successful candidate will be able to review and negotiate agreements for concerts/music touring, live comedy, physical production, film, scripted and unscripted television, endorsements, and branding.


Duties

· Negotiate a variety of agreements, including but not limited to those for marketing, branding, music, and both above and below-the-line deals

· Serve as strategic advisor and business partner to agents and executives, providing decision-making support and guidance related to deals and contract negotiations

· Apply innovative problem-solving skills and practical business judgment to balance IAG’s business needs and acceptable levels of risk

· Foster positive, long-term internal and external client relationships with agents, managers, and artists

· Other duties as assigned


Skills And Qualifications

· Impeccable interpersonal skills with an ability to tailor communication based on the needs of various stakeholders (e.g. agents, managers, studio/network business affairs, producers, other attorneys)

· Strong organizational skills: impeccable ability to multi-task and prioritize work to meet deadlines

· Meticulous attention to detail: resourceful, proactive, reliable, trustworthy, assertive, and excellent at drafting

· An analytic, solution-oriented approach with impeccable follow-through

· Ability to maintain discretion and a high level of confidentiality
